Onboarding: SDK parity — Larkbyte clients

The Swift and Kotlin SDKs for Larkbyte are kept at feature parity each release; the parity matrix lists any temporary gaps, such as offline queueing, which shipped on Kotlin first. When customers report a missing feature, check the matrix before escalating. To open the internal parity dashboard you must unlock the shared support keystore; its recovery passphrase appears below.

vault phrase of tajop-haduf = holath-brivan-wenax

Handover note — Crumbwheel order cutoffs.

Welcome aboard. The bakery cutoff rule in Crumbwheel closes same-day orders at 14:00 local to each storefront, not UTC — this has bitten us twice. Holiday overrides live in the calendar service and take precedence silently, so always check there first when a cutoff looks wrong. To unlock the calendar service's admin console after a restart, enter the recovery passphrase below.

vault phrase of bagap-bahaf = silion-pelox-sorox-casdor-quenwyn-fraax-eliox-praael-kelion-quenvan-kasox-rusael-norius-belvan

## Sensor drift: what to do at 3am

If the GrowLoop controller starts reporting humidity swings that don't match the backup probes in the Fernwick greenhouse, it's almost always sensor drift, not an actual climate event. Don't panic and don't touch the vents manually. First, restart the calibration daemon and give it ten minutes to re-baseline. If readings still disagree by more than 5%, flip the controller into safe mode. The safe-mode thresholds it will use are these.

config for yahap-bajof:
[istix]
host = istix.qorvelsys.internal
user = istix_svc
database = istix_prod

Hi Dara — quick handover before I'm off next week. The shuttle-bus gate at the Larkspur Yard entrance is acting up again; the sensor misses the morning bus about once a week, so the driver will buzz reception when it happens. Just wave them through on the camera and log it in the gate sheet. Ferno Transit is sending someone Thursday to look at it. If you need to open the gate manually, use the keypad by the barrier — the code is below.

door code, yagap-bahof: bdg-O-05